Abstract
Crystals of Sr3NiPtO6 and Sr3CuPtO6 were grown from a K2CO3 flux containing SrCO3, NiO or CuO, and Pt metal powder, at 1150 degrees C. The structure o f Sr3NiPtO6 was solved by means of single-crystal X-ray diffraction analysi s. The structure was refined in space group R (3) over bar c, with a = 9.58 32(1) Angstrom and c = 11.1964(1) Angstrom. Sr3CuPtO6 and Sr3NiPtO6 are str ucturally related to the parent compound, A(4)PtO(6) (A = Ca, Sr, Ba), and contain infinite chains of alternating, face-sharing PtO6 octahedra and A'O -6 (A' = Ni, Cu) trigonal prisms. Magnetic measurements were carried out on both samples using 3-5 mm long single crystals. Magnetic susceptibility st udies on oriented single crystals of Sr3NiPtO6 indicate the presence of Ni( II) ions with a large single-ion anisotropy (D = 93.7(5) K, g(parallel to) = 2.143(6), and g(perpendicular to) = 2.392(4)). In contrast, Sr3CuPtO6 exh ibits S = 1/2 Heisenberg linear chain antiferromagnetism with J/k = -24.7(1 ) K, J'/k = -7.3(8) K, g(parallel to) = 2.127(6), and g(perpendicular to) = 2.150(6).
